The cheapest way to get from Bargo to Yass is to bus which costs $24 - $40 and takes 5h 33m.
The fastest way to get from Bargo to Yass is to drive which takes 1h 58m and costs $30 - $50.
No, there is no direct bus from Bargo to Yass. However, there are services departing from Bargo Shops, Noongah St and arriving at Banjo Patterson Park, Rossi St via Bowral Station, Coach Stop and Yass Junction, Coach Stop.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 33m.
No, there is no direct train from Bargo station to Yass. However, there are services departing from Bargo Station and arriving at Yass Junction via Moss Vale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 44m.
The distance between Bargo and Yass is 220 km. The road distance is 189.6 km.
The best way to get from Bargo to Yass without a car is to train which takes 4h 44m and costs $30 - $170.
It takes approximately 4h 44m to get from Bargo to Yass, including transfers.
Bargo to Yass bus services, operated by NSW TrainLink, depart from Bowral Station, Coach Stop.
Bargo to Yass train services, operated by Intercity Trains, depart from Bargo Station.
The best way to get from Bargo to Yass is to train which takes 4h 44m and costs $30 - $170.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s $24 - $40 and takes 5h 33m.
